Détails du poste
- Lieu de travail : Montreal (Hybride)
- Type de poste : Permanent à temps plein
Description du poste
Rockwell Automation est un leader technologique mondial qui aide les fabricants à produire davantage, à préserver l’environnement et à s’adapter plus rapidement. Avec plus de 28 000 employés qui améliorent le monde chaque jour, nous savons que nous avons quelque chose de spécial. Derrière nos clients, des entreprises remarquables qui contribuent à nourrir le monde, à fournir des médicaments qui sauvent des vies à l’échelle mondiale, ainsi qu’à se concentrer sur l’eau propre et la mobilité écologique, nos employés sont des résolveurs de problèmes motivés, fiers de savoir que leur travail change le monde pour le mieux.
Nous accueillons tous les créateurs, les esprits novateurs et les personnes qui aiment relever des défis, à la recherche d’un endroit où donner le meilleur d’eux-mêmes. Si c’est votre cas, nous serions ravis de vous compter parmi nous.
En tant qu'ingénieur(e) logiciel principal(e) au sein de l'équipe de développement FTDS, vous concevrez, développerez et livrerez des plateformes fiables et évolutives supportant des systèmes et services critiques à l'échelle de l'entreprise. Vous assurerez également un leadership technique sur les projets, en guidant les décisions de conception et l'exécution, tout en collaborant étroitement avec les équipes d'ingénierie, de produits et de gestion de projets.
Ce poste est basé à Brossard (QC) en mode hybride. Vous relèverez du Chef d'équipe, génie logiciel.
Responsabilités
- Concevoir, développer et livrer des applications et services full‑stacks évolutifs.
- Collaborer avec des équipes multidisciplinaires afin de développer des solutions logicielles de haute qualité.
- Développer et maintenir des services frontend et backend.
- Assumer le rôle de responsable technique transversal pour des projets logiciels et en assurer la livraison.
- Orienter les décisions de conception aux niveaux système et composant en équilibrant performance, sécurité, robustesse et maintenabilité.
- Identifier, analyser et résoudre des problématiques techniques complexes.
- Fournir un encadrement technique et du mentorat aux membres de l'équipe.
- Collaborer étroitement avec les équipes de produits, de projets, de qualité et d'ingénierie globale.
- Assurer le respect des processus du cycle de vie du développement logiciel (revues, documentation, livraisons).
- Contribuer à la documentation technique (spécifications, plans d'intégration, analyses de risques).
- Promouvoir les bonnes pratiques de développement (qualité du code, automatisation, CI/CD).
Qualifications
Exigences minimales
- Baccalauréat en génie, en informatique ou expérience équivalente pertinente.
- Autorisation légale de travailler au Canada.
Atouts
- 8 ans ou plus d'expérience pertinente en développement logiciel.
- Expérience avec des technologies modernes (TypeScript, GraphQL, REST-API, Python).
- Excellentes compétences en communication en français et en anglais (oral et écrit).
- Expérience démontrée en leadership technique de projets logiciels.
- Expérience en conception et intégration de systèmes distribués et évolutifs.
- Connaissance des environnements infonuagiques et des technologies de conteneurisation (Docker, Kubernetes).
- Expérience en développement d'applications infonuagiques, incluant le frontend.
- Bonne compréhension des méthodologies Agile et du cycle de vie logiciel.
- Expérience avec divers protocoles (HTTPS, JSON, RPC, WebSocket).
- Expérience avec les pipelines CI/CD (ex. GitHub Actions, FluxCD).
- Expérience dans le domaine manufacturier ou de l'automatisation industrielle (atout).
- Expérience avec des outils d'IA générative (ex. GitHub Copilot).
Ce que nous offrons
- Régime complet d'assurances (médical et dentaire)
- Compte de gestion des dépenses de santé (selon le régime)
- Programme d'aide aux employés (PAE)
- Régimes d'épargne et de retraite avec contribution de l'employeur (REER, CELI, etc.)
- Régime de retraite à cotisation déterminée payé par l'employeur
- Congés payés et congés pour activités bénévoles
- Programme de remboursement d'activités de mieux‑être
- Bonification des congés parentaux
- Horaire de travail flexible favorisant l'équilibre travail‑vie personnelle
Énoncé d'inclusion
Chez Rockwell Automation, nous valorisons un milieu de travail diversifié, inclusif et authentique. Si ce poste vous intéresse, mais que votre profil ne correspond pas parfaitement à toutes les qualifications, nous vous encourageons à soumettre votre candidature.
Ce poste s'inscrit dans une gamme d'emplois. Le niveau et la rémunération seront déterminés en fonction de l'expérience.
As Rockwell is a global company, candidates must be bilingual or able to communicate in English (spoken and written).
Rockwell Automation’s hybrid policy aligns that employees are expected to work at a Rockwell location at least Mondays, Tuesdays, and Thursdays unless they have a business obligation out of the office.